Henry Ford's most important invention was the Model T automobile. Released in 1908, it revolutionized transportation and manufacturing. By implementing assembly line production, Ford made cars affordable for the average American, which transformed modern industry and paved the way for the future of mass production.

  1. How did the Model T impact the automotive industry? The Model T made automobiles accessible to the average American, revolutionizing the industry with mass production techniques.
  2. What other inventions did Henry Ford contribute to? Henry Ford also pioneered assembly line production techniques and improved automobile safety and efficiency.
  3. When was the Model T first released? The Model T was first released in 1908 and helped to change transportation forever.
  4. What was the significance of assembly line production? Assembly line production significantly lowered the cost of manufacturing, allowing for mass production of goods and making them affordable for consumers.
